TL-Nexis and DM Waterfront Parks and Promenade Modular Set

I blame Nexis (mrbisonn) for this set. He sent me a nice model of an anchor and… I let it ran away and make babies with Don Miguel Waterfront Promenade lots. Here’s the result. Six parks, five of which work as waterfront pieces

Content :

TL-DM WTF Park Paths 
TL-DM WTF Addons Paths

That you can variously combine with :

TL-DM WTF Large Promenade 11x4

and its modular versions : 

TL-DM WTF PromenadePark East
TL-DM WTF PromenadePark Center 5x5
TL-DM WTF PromenadePark West

and with : TL-Nexis WTF Anchor Park 6x5

and its fully waterfronty version (to be combined with the paths):

TL-Nexis WTF Anchor Park 6x5 Open

General warnings :
(1) This is for SC4 Rush Hour.
(2) I play with NAM36, RRW-EU selection (it shouldn’t interfere here, but you never know !)
(3) I also play with Twrecks Maxis HD Tree Replacement (if you don’t use it, your trees might look a bit different [not these trees !] ; perhaps you should use it…)
 (4) I play Nights. Depending on your using or not a Light Replacement Mod, the lighting will be slightly different, but There Will Be Light. If you dont want it, you can either tweak my lights in the Lot Editor or take them out of my Essentials  folder dep.
(5) I like trees. I make intensive use of trees. Especially Girafe tree collection on the LEX ; so here’s the link, once for all ; just follow it into the woods, when indicated.
